I've been collecting some engine data on my Renesis 4
port powered RV-7A with a Catto 76X88 2 blade prop. I use Mogas
with 0.6 oz Wal-Mart 2 stroke and Marvel Mystery oil mixed 50% each.
Static is 5550 rpm. In climb at full power I get 5700 rpm at about 85
knots. Level at 2000 ft msl and 155 mph I turn 5200 rpm on the
engine @ 20mpg. At 170 mph I turn 5800 rpm. At 185 mph I turn
6200 rpm. I have the B gearbox 2.85:1 engine to prop ratio.
I now have over 500 flying hours. I use Mobil 1 - 15W
50 synthetic oil and change it every 50 hours.
My flying for the last year and a half includes 2 to 3 very
short flights each week to play tennis (7.5 minutes each way). I
warm the engine to at least 110 deg F. before going to 3200 rpm
for engine checks. I takeoff full throttle when the oil
and water are over 120 deg. F.
